Heating, Air Conditioning, Ventilation & Refrigeration Maintenance Technology/Technician at State Technical College of Missouri

If you plan to study heating, air conditioning, ventilation and refrigeration maintenance technology/technician, take a look at what State Technical College of Missouri has to offer and decide if the program is a good match for you. Get started with the following essential facts.

STC is located in Linn, Missouri and has a total student population of 1,756. During the the most recent year for which data is available, 30 students received their associate's degree in HVACR.

STC Heating, Air Conditioning, Ventilation & Refrigeration Maintenance Technology/Technician Associate’s Program

7% Women
For the most recent academic year available, 93% of HVACR associate's degrees went to men and 7% went to women. The typical associate's degree program in HVACR only graduates about 4% women each year. The program at STC may seem more female-friendly since it graduates 3% more women than average.
